Simple Acoustic Grating Modulators
Applied Optics, 1972Simple low-cost modulators based on the Raman-Nath regime of acoustooptic diffraction have been demonstrated. Experimental results on internal laser modulators constructed from some dense flint glasses and fused quartz are presented. 100% modulation of He-Ne lasers with rise times on the order of 1 musec are obtained with 10-MHz modulator drive powers ...

Simple Divisible Modules Over Integral Domains
Canadian Mathematical Bulletin, 1989AbstractAn R-module is a simple divisible module if it is a nonzero divisible module that has no proper non-zero divisible submodules. We study simple divisible modules and their endomorphism rings, give some examples and determine all simple divisible modules over some classes of rings.

Strongly Simple-Injective Rings and Modules
Algebra Colloquium, 2008If M and N are right R-modules, M is called simple-N-injective if every R-homomorphism γ from a submodule K of N into M with γ(K) simple extends to N. In this paper, a right R-module M is called strongly simple-injective if M is simple-N-injective for every right R-module N.
